Kyle Odell

After earning Reserve NJSA Purebred Barrow honors at The Exposition, Kyle Odell took a break from the summer show season to share some of the traditions, goals, and superstitions that have become part of his showring journey.


What is your favorite way to celebrate a win?
My favorite way to celebrate is definitely hanging out with the people that made it all possible for me to get into the position of success. We usually hang back at the fairgrounds or find a local pizza restaurant and celebrate!!

What’s your dream show to win?
I’d say for where I am at in my career with not a lot of time left, I have already won my dream show with that being the American Royal. I think The Exposition Crossbred Barrow or Gilt Show would be the next on that list.

Who is another exhibitor that you look up to?
I don’t think there is an exhibitor I look up to just because I am older and at the end of my show career, but my goal is to have people look up to me. When I was younger there were always those exhibitors that my mom, dad, and even helpers would make me watch every time they stepped into the ring. Being that kind of role model for younger exhibitors is a goal of mine.

What’s one thing you can’t go without during a show?
I wear a certain necklace every time I go into the ring that I actually won at a Walmart claw machine at a pig show years ago. That same weekend I won both shows I was exhibiting in. I’m very superstitious about that necklace! If you know, you know!!!!!

Besides summer shows, what’s something else you enjoy doing during the summer?
My brother and I are really into bow fishing on our local lake and being outdoors in general, whether that’s barbecuing or late-night pickleball.
